My comments are mostly about the situation of FTing in a TCer and not directed at you personally. Take it or leave it...
My wife travels all the time for work and I go camping. Mostly about a week or two. I know there are many full timers and god bless them but I'm ready to go home after about a week. But, I'm not really set up to full time it in my 1181. I have seen TCer's that are ready to full time like the mammoth as they can be ordered with home amenities like a washer/dryer unit and things like that. Even though the mammoth is huge for a truck camper it's still pretty small to live in. Your going to be working and playing in your situation that means two sets of cloths, shoes, snow boots, food for at least three meals a day x 7 days, washing and drying cloths at a laundromat, dumping, fresh water, electric etc.. have all just become a new routine so you can live in your TCer. Now you will have to provide yourself with all these amenities instead of just paying for them. That's big! Propane use in a northeastern winter is going to be twice a week filling routine and truck campers are cold even with the best insulation. When you open your door every bit of heat in that unit is going out on the ground. If your retired and living in a warmer climate I would think would shave off some of this but your not. As far as dating...LOL I can't say, I haven't had a date in 33 years. I genuinely wish you good luck but would recommend a stationary TT set up in a camp ground permanently.
